Timezone in Toplu
Toplu is located in the Europe/Istanbul timezone, which operates at UTC+3 during standard time. This timezone does not observe daylight saving time, meaning the UTC offset remains consistent throughout the year. As a result, there are no seasonal clock changes, simplifying timekeeping for both residents and those trying to coordinate with them.
